Carrot Walnut Bread Recipe

Moist bread filled with fresh grated carrots and walnuts. Perfect to have with a cup of coffee or tea.

Ingredients
  

  • 2 large Eggs
  • 1 cup Sugar 200 grams
  • cup Vegetable oil 160 ml
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• 1 ½ cup All Purpose Flour / Maida 180 grams
  • ¾ teaspoon Ba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on Cinnamon powder
  • ¼ teaspoon Salt
  • 1 ½ cups Carrots grated
  • ½ cup Walnuts

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 180 degree c
  • Line a loaf pan with parchment paper. Set aside.
  • Take oil, sugar, vanilla, egg in a bowl and mix well. This is your wet ingredients. Set this aside.
  • Take flour, cinnamon, baking soda and salt in a bowl and mix well. This is your dry ingredients
  • Now add dry ingredients to your wet ingredients. Fold gently.
  • Add in carrots and walnuts and fold gently.
  • Now add in the chopped walnuts and mix well.
  • Spoon this into the loaf pan, top with chopped walnuts and bake for 50 mins to 1 hour.
  • Remove this from oven and cool for 15 mins at room temp.
  • Slice and serve.

Notes

1)Instead of oil you can use melted butter for more flavour.
2)Don't over mix the batter else it will get hard and dry.
3)Adding freshly grated carrots will keep the bread moist.
4)Instead of walnuts you can use any nuts of your choice.

STORING & SERVING:

Once bread is cooled completely, cover it in plastic wrap. Secure it with some aluminum foil. You could either store in fridge for a week. Or store in freezer for a month.
Thaw the bread in fridge overnight. Slice and serve.
Serve it warm with a slathering of butter.
